A race car moving with a constant speed of 60 m/s completes one lap around circular track in 50 s What is the magnitude of the centripetal acceleration of the race car?

7.5 m/s^2



60X50=3000


3000=2(pie)r


r=477.46m


a=60^2/477.46=7.5

A juggler throws two balls to the same height so that one is at the halfway point going up when the other is at the hallway point coming down. At that point:

Their accelerations are equal but their velocities are equal and opposite.

Which of the following situations is impossible about an object?

An object has constant nonzero velocity and changing acceleration.

The net force on a moving object suddenly becomes zero and remains zero. The object will

Continue at constant velocity.

What force keeps your car from sliding off the road as you round a corner?

Static friction towards the center of the curve you are traveling in.

Two rocks that are equal mass are tied to massless strings and whiled in nearly horizontal circles at the same speed. One string is twice as long as the other. What is the tension in the shorter string compared to the tensions in the longer one?

T1=2(T2)

A spring gun shoots out a plastic ball at speed v. The spring is then compressed twice the distance is was on the first shot. By what factor is the ball's speed increased?

2

A pendulum swings in a vertical plane. At the bottom of the swing, the kinetic energy is 8 J and the gravitational potential energy is 4 J. A the highest point of its swing, the kinetic and gravitational potential energies are

Kinetic energy=0J, Gravitational Potential Energy=12 J

As a simple pendulum swings back and forth, the forces acting on the suspended mass are the force of gravity, the tension in the supporting cord, and air resistance. Which of these forces only does negative work during the motion of the pendulum?

Air Resistance

The planet Saturn has about 100 times the mass of the earth and is about 10 times farther from the sun than the earth is. Compared to the acceleration of the earth caused by the sun's gravitational pull, how great is the acceleration of saturn due to the sun's gravitation?

1/100 as great

If a constant non-zero net torque is applied to an object that object will

rotate with constant angular acceleration

The horizontal bar in the figure will remain horizontal if. . .

The horizontal bar in the figure will remain horizontal if. . .

R1=R2 and M1=M2

The Earth orbits the Sun in an elliptical orbit. Ignore any friction which may be present. What happens over time to the Earth's angular momentum about the Sun?

It remains constant

The space station stabilizer tickets are malfunctioning, but the space station rotation rate must be slowed down before a supply ship can dock with it. Which of the following actions of the astronauts would slow the rotation rate of the space station?

Move as much mass as far as possible away from the axis of rotation of the space station.

A small object is attached to a horizontal spring and set in simple harmonic motion with amplitude A and period T. How long does it take for the object to travel a total distance of 6A.

3T/2
